Saint-Bonnet-Elvert is a commune of France[1]. Saint-Bonnet-Elvert has Wikipedia articles in 17 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[2]
Key Facts
- Saint-Bonnet-Elvert is located in Corrèze[3].
- Saint-Bonnet-Elvert is located in Arrondissement of Tulle[4].
- Saint-Bonnet-Elvert is in the country of France[5].
